Since the config was created in live, it remained after installation. Now the config will be created at the first start of live and only if /image/ALTLinux/ is present (it will not be available when bootloading via http or ftp). After installing live, the package will be deleted and the config will not be created at the first start.

We've got some parts of it in build-distro feature, and some went to dev feature for no real reason. But a bare installer might go without package base, and LiveCDs other than live-builder might find local repository useful given aufs2 root overlay. Now the overall scheme is more straightforward: - a distro: + asks that a package repo be included + cares to further add the packages to it - a repo feature: + pulls in sub/main for it to happen + provides genbasedir script to create repo metadata + supplements live feature with repo configuration
